Nice!! Good thing Troy comes over to the Quincy area lots during the season. You should try to meet up with him to hand deliver it  and he can hear you call and possibly even tweak it for you.

If you get in contact with Troy and buy one of his calls in person, he will listen to your call and adjust it to you.  He can swap out the reeds, etc to help you produce the sound you like.  If you take him out to dinner, he may also offer to help coach you on your technique if needed.  Another great resource that goes the extra mile to help you out.
